Transaction b04c59057072dfcbdb3a5f62b6ef7ebea757a2a538df1b3a19cff04baf101b25

6 Input
2 Outputs
  • b04c59057072dfcbdb3a5f62b6ef7ebea757a2a538df1b3a19cff04baf101b25:0
  • value  1012335
    address  38rTQuhvQ2RKgRFEiKHwsxkaJ2DmF3v2VS
  • b04c59057072dfcbdb3a5f62b6ef7ebea757a2a538df1b3a19cff04baf101b25:1
  • value  16355960
    address  14p9D1t14hjSLm3D9egoQRRvjnZS6zJTV7